After sharing your content, it\u2019s essential to see what\u2019s working and what\u2019s not. Using tools like Google Analytics can help track how much traffic you\u2019re getting, where it\u2019s coming from, and how users are interacting with your posts. <\/p>\n
I recommend checking metrics like bounce rate and average session duration to get a clear picture of reader engagement. It\u2019s all about refining your approach based on these insights \u2013 tweak and iterate to match your audience’s preferences!<\/p>\n
Additionally, set goals for your traffic numbers. It can be a powerful motivator to see your growth over time and really pushes you to implement strategies that continually attract visitors.<\/p>\n

The internet is packed with forums and groups dedicated to nearly every topic imaginable. I\u2019ve found gold in places like Reddit and Facebook groups that resonate with my niche. Engaging in these platforms can drive targeted traffic to your content, especially when you provide genuine value.<\/p>\n
Start by lurking for a bit; get a feel for the community rules and the kind of content that gets engagement. Once you\u2019re comfortable, share your insights and content where it fits organically. It\u2019s all about striking a balance between promotion and contribution.<\/p>\n
Remember, spamming links will just get you booted. Focus on being a valuable member of the community, and traffic will follow.<\/p>\n

Creating quality content is genuinely at the heart of any successful online marketing strategy. I can\u2019t stress enough the importance of understanding SEO, which helps your content get found by search engines. Keywords are your friends, but remember to use them naturally.<\/p>\n
From personal experience, I find that writing engaging headlines can drastically affect click-through rates. Spend time crafting the perfect title that sparks curiosity while still being clear about what the content offers. <\/p>\n
Make sure your articles are well-structured, use headers effectively, and include internal links to other content you\u2019ve created. This not only improves SEO but also encourages readers to explore more of your work.<\/p>\n
Once you\u2019ve created killer content, ensure that it gets in front of an audience. Platforms like LinkedIn, Quora, or even content aggregation sites can help amplify the reach of your posts. When I share my articles across multiple channels, I usually see a notable uptick in traffic.<\/p>\n
Don\u2019t forget to engage with the communities on these platforms. For instance, answering questions on Quora with insights and linking back to your relevant articles (when appropriate) encourages people to check out your content.<\/p>\n
